Abstract

The present paper demonstrates the possibility of evaluating physical and mechanical properties of the material using the results on its acoustic characteristic measurements by the example of the Ti-based alloy with different β-stabilizing additives. Conventional methods based on pulse and resonant excitations of material samples have been applied to measure acoustic characteristics. The measured acoustic characteristics have been used to calculate the total complex of elastic moduli that determines mechanical behaviour of the material. Correlation between the acoustic characteristics and the material microhardness has been revealed.
